Hi Krishna, If you're using a VFS-like FSAL, I wouldn't think you'd want to be hard limited to 4K open files.
It could be useful to have more flexibility in (choice of?) LRU reclaim strategy, but to start with, I'd raise this limit (on Linux, /proc/sys/fs/nr_open, etc).
